Divus Galerius, died 311. Follis (Bronze, 25 mm, 6.89 g, 12 h), Alexandria, circa 311. DIVO MAXIMIANO MAXIMINVS AVG FIL Laureate head of Divus Galerius to right. Rev. AETERNAE MEMORIAE GAL MAXIMIANI / (crescent) - Γ / K - P / ALE Large altar with flames and two horns on top, decorated with eagle standing left on wreath, head turned to right and holding wreath in beak. RIC 133. Faint deposits, otherwise, good very fine.
